Father’s Day – Last Minute Grandfather Gift Ideas
Nothing says, “Grandfather, I love you,” more than a personalized gift given from the heart that expresses exactly what your special grandfather meant to you. If you need a last minute gift idea, I have some suggestions. You can use these Father’s Day quotes and sayings for Grandfather to make him one of these special Father’s Day Gifts.
Grandfather Gift Ideas using Grandfather Quotes and Sayings
- You can choose a special quote or saying below and include it with a photo of the two of you together, or with a photo of yourself. Place it in a shadow box and add objects that represent memories that you two share or that remind you of your grandfather.
- Another suggestion is to frame the photo with the saying and decorate the outside of the frame instead.
- If you act quickly, you could also have the saying or quote inscribed on something that your grandfather would enjoy receiving…or…
- For those of you who enjoy embroidery or sewing, you could stitch the saying on a decorative pillow…or you could pay someone to do it for you.
- For someone handy with working with wood, the saying could be carved or burned into a plaque…or printed and decoupaged on wood or glass.
- One idea that was suggested to me is to print the saying or quote in a decorative font, place it in a decorative frame, place “feet” on the four corners and “handles” on the bottom and top front sections of the frame…and you have a personalized tray to give Grandfather for Father’s Day. (more…)

My granddaughter, Kaitlin, and I put our heads together and wrote a special Father’s Day poem for her grandfather, my husband, whom she calls Poppy. This poem is for Grandpa because she wanted a lot of grandchildren to be able to use this poem for their Grandpa. She said to tell you that you can replace the word Grandpa with Poppy, Grandfather, Grand Dad, Granddad, PopPop, or whatever loving term Grandfather is affectionately called.
A Poem for My Grandpa
My Grandpa, you are so special to me,
You teach me to be happy and free.
I love spending our fun days together,
We always find a new adventure.
You don’t mind answering my questions “Why?”,
You pick me up and carry me high.
My Grandpa, you take the time to teach,
And let me see things above my reach.
With you, I always feel safe and secure,
I’ll love you forever, ever more.
We say goodbye with a hug and kiss,
As I make a big, big special wish…
My wish for you, Grandpa, please, please don’t go.
Why? Because I love, love, love you so….
~ by Kaitlin and Nana ~

The following grandfather poem is dedicated to all the wonderful, caring grandfathers in celebration of Father’s Day.
Grandfathers Are Fathers Who Are Grand
Grandfathers are fathers who are grand,
Restoring the sense that our most precious things
Are those that do not change much over time.
No love of childhood is more sublime,
Demanding little, giving on demand,
Far more inclined than most to grant the wings
Allowing us to reach enchanted lands.
Though grandfathers must serve as second fathers,
Helping out with young and restless hearts,
Each has all the patience wisdom brings,
Remembering our passions more than others,
Soothing us with old and well-honed arts.
~ Author Unknown ~
